Output 778b22d8a5c0c71dc490601b1f59d5705f04f9c53af61ce01b36e92ef60e4379:0

value
1390639460
script pubkey
OP_0 OP_PUSHBYTES_20 32c246ce799bf9bedecad79ef4ff84fb9663f881
address
bc1qxtpydnnen0umahk26700fluylwtx87yp9clcjt
transaction
778b22d8a5c0c71dc490601b1f59d5705f04f9c53af61ce01b36e92ef60e4379
spent
true